Ruston vs Aberdeen
Side-by-side comparison
How does Ruston, WA compare to Aberdeen, WA? Ruston has a population of 1,293 with a median household income of $113,971, while Aberdeen has 17,040 residents and a median income of $52,181.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Ruston, WA | Aberdeen, WA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 1,293 | 17,040 | -92.4% |
| Median Age | 47.8 | 36.9 | +29.5% |
| Foreign Born % | 9.1% | 8.5% | +7.1% |
| Metric | Ruston | Aberdeen |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$113,971 | $52,181 | +118.4% |
| Unemployment | 1.8% | 8.5% | -78.8% |
| Poverty Rate | 7.3% | 22.2% | -67.1% |
| Bachelor's+ | 58% | 14.7% | +294.6% |
| Metric | Ruston | Aberdeen |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$808,200 | $225,100 | +259.0% |
| Median Rent | $2489/mo | $1024/mo | +143.1% |
| Housing Units | 697 | 7,051 | -90.1% |
